September, 1963 OWNER-AMATEUR CHAMPIONSHIP STAKE FAIR WARNING VIRGINIA LEE THOMPSON, UP Owned by Mrs. Robert F. Thompson Dallas, Texas Trained by Wallace Brandon Grapevine, Texas @ RSE In the greatest victory of her meteoric career in the she ring, young Virginia Lee (Doodles) Thompson rode her splendi black mare, FAIR WARNING, to the World's Championship in the 1963 National Celebration’s Owner • Amateur Stake, one of the most intensely contested classes in the entire show. With this im­ pressive victory the young Texan and her mount convinced all the crowd that they are strong contenders for the adult, as well as the juvenile competition. FAIR WARNING, owned by Mrs. Robert F. Thompson, Doodles' mother, is recognized as one of the truly great mares of the breed, and her talented rider is capable of getting the best out of her.
